TRANSFERRING THE PATIENT
Stand Up Lift Model RPS350-2
26
Part No. 1145811
Transferring to a Commode
NOTE:
For
this
procedure,
refer
to
FIGURE 5.1.
WARNING
Invacare recommends locking the rear
swivel casters only when positioning or
removing the sling from around the
patient.
1. Lift
the
patient
from
the
bed.
Refer
to
Lifting
the
Patient
on
page 21.
2. Press
the
boom
up
button
to
elevate
the
patient
high
enough
to
clear
the
arms
of
the
commode
chair.
Their
weight
will
be
supported
by
the
stand
up
lift.
Refer
to
Detail
“A”.
3. Guide
the
patient
onto
the
commode
chair.
This
may
require
two
assistants.
4. Press
the
down
arrow
button
to
lower
the
patient
onto
the
commode
chair.
5. Lock
the
rear
swivel
casters
on
the
stand
up
lift.
6. Perform
one
of
the
following
(refer
to
Detail
“B”):
• Standing
Sling
‐
unhook
the
standing
sling
from
the
attachment
points
on
the
stand
up
lift.
• Transport
Sling
‐
i. Unhook
the
transport
sling
from
the
bottom
attachment
points
on
the
stand
up
lift.
ii. Lift
up
on
the
patient’s
legs
and
remove
the
thigh
supports
from
underneath
the
patient.
iii. If
desired,
unhook
the
transport
sling
from
the
top
attachment
points
on
the
stand
up
lift.
NOTE:
The
patient
can
remain
in
the
upper
portion
of
the
transport
sling
while
using
the
commode.
